Nicholas Jerrard, MD

Phone
(909) 674-7832
Fax
(909) 245-0229
31739 Riverside Dr Ste E, Ped Partners Lake Elsinore, Lake Elsinore, CA 92530

Directions to 31739 Riverside Dr Ste E, Ped Partners Lake Elsinore, Lake Elsinore, CA 92530

From:

To: